AWS 기술 블로그

Category: Database

Amazon Aurora 및 Amazon RDS의 MySQL 데이터베이스에 대한 Amazon RDS 연장 지원 소개

이 글은 AWS Database Blog에 게시된 Introducing Amazon RDS Extended Support for MySQL databases on Amazon Aurora and Amazon RDS by Vijay Karumajji을 한국어 번역 및 편집하였습니다. MySQL Community Version v5.7의 서비스 지원이 2023년 10월에 종료(end-of-life)됨에 따라 (p. 24 참고) Amazon Web Services (AWS)는 이에 따른 중대한 변화를 준비하고 있습니다. MySQL 5.7의 커뮤니티 서비스 지원이 […]

클라우드 데이터베이스 엔지니어의 역할 강화

이 글은 AWS Database Blog에 게시된 Empowering the role of the cloud database engineer by Wendy Neu and Rajib Sadhu을 한국어 번역 및 편집하였습니다. 자동화는 전통적인 데이터베이스 관리자(DBA)에게 보상이자 선물이었습니다. DBA의 대부분의 기존 역할에는 프로비저닝, 접근 관리, 유지 관리, 모니터링, 고가용성 및 백업/복원이 포함됩니다. 시리즈의 1부에서 우리는 그 역할이 플랫폼보다는 애플리케이션에 더 집중하도록 어떻게 진화했는지에 […]

Amazon CloudWatch를 이용한 Amazon Aurora I/O Optimized 기능에 대한 비용 절감 예상하기

이 글은 AWS Database Blog에 게시된 Estimate cost savings for the Amazon Aurora I/O-Optimized feature using Amazon CloudWatch Sarabjeet Singh을 한국어 번역 및 편집하였습니다. Amazon Aurora는 고급 상용 데이터베이스의 속도와 가용성을 오픈 소스 데이터베이스의 간편함과 비용 효율성을 결합한 관계형 데이터베이스 서비스입니다. Aurora는 MySQL과 PostgreSQL 오픈 소스 데이터베이스 엔진을 지원합니다. Aurora 스토리지는 공유 클러스터 스토리지 아키텍처로 […]

AWS Glue와 Amazon Athena를 활용한 MongoDB 데이터 분석 방법 비교하기

IoT 디바이스 또는 웹/앱 애플리케이션에서 발생되는 데이터는 JSON 다큐먼트 형태로 주로 저장되고 있으며, 이 데이터에 대한 분석 요구가 증대됨에 따라 MongoDB와 같은 다큐먼트 지향 데이터베이스 사용도 늘어나고 있습니다. AWS에서 제공되는 분석 서비스는 완전관리형 또는 서버리스 형태로 제공되어 사용자의 분석패턴에 따라 다양한 서비스를 활용할 수 있습니다. 이번 게시글에서는 여러 분석 서비스 중 Amazon Athena를 활용하여 ad-hoc […]

Amazon Aurora를 어플리케이션 개발자가 사용하기 위한 10가지 팁 – 2부

이 글은 AWS Database Delivery Blog에 게시된 10 Amazon Aurora tips for application developers – Part 2 by Rajeev Sakhuja을 한국어 번역 및 편집하였습니다. 이 글은 Amazon Aurora를 어플리케이션 개발자가 사용하기 위한 10가지 팁 (10 Amazon Aurora tips for application developers) 게시물의 2부작 시리즈의 두번째 게시물 입니다. 1부에서는 10가지 팁중 처음 5가지 팁을 공유 했습니다. […]

Amazon RDS Proxy 를 이용한 스푼라디오 서비스 무중단 변경

SpoonRadio는 “Connect the world with people’s stories” 라는 목표를 갖고 한국, 일본, 미국, 대만 등 총 21개국, Global User 20M 명에게 서비스 하고 있습니다. SpoonRadio는 누구나 편하게 목소리로 소통할 수 있는 소셜 플랫폼으로 탄생 하였고, 소통과 더불어 많은 즐길거리를 만들어 DJ 와 청취자 사이의 관계를 넘어 서로 긴밀한 관계가 유지 되도록 새로운 시도를 지속하고 있습니다. […]

Amazon Aurora를 애플리케이션 개발자가 사용하기 위한 10가지 팁 – 1부

이 글은 AWS Database Delivery Blog에 게시된 10 Amazon Aurora tips for application developers – Part 1 by Rajeev Sakhuja을 한국어 번역 및 편집하였습니다. Amazon Aurora는 MySQL 및 PostgreSQL과 호환되는 클라우드-네이티브 애플리케이션을 구축할 수 있는 엔터프라이즈 등급의 데이터베이스 엔진입니다. 애플리케이션 개발자는 코드를 작성하기 위해 Java 애플리케이션을 위한 JDBC 드라이버, Java 스크립트 애플리케이션을 위한 NodeJS 패키지들과 […]

Amazon DynamoDB를 위한 백업 전략

이 글은 AWS Database Delivery Blog에 게시된 Backup strategies for Amazon DynamoDB by Ted Zamborsky을 한국어 번역 및 편집하였습니다. 데이터베이스에 관해 논의할 때 가장 중요한 질문 중 하나는 “데이터를 어떻게 백업하고 복원할 것인가?”입니다. 백업은 모든 재해 복구 전략의 핵심 구성 요소이며, 주로 복구 시점 목표(RPO)와 복구 시간 목표(RTO)에 따라 관리됩니다. 백업 전략은 최소한의 관리만으로 요구사항을 지원하고, 비지니스에 […]

GUI 환경을 이용하여 안전하게 Amazon RDS 또는 Amazon EC2 DB 인스턴스에 원격 접근하기

이 글은 AWS Database Blog에 게시된 Securely connect to an Amazon RDS or Amazon EC2 database instance remotely with your preferred GUI by Jonathan Kerr, Uwe Kuechler, and Vincent Lesierse를 한국어로 번역 및 편집하였습니다. 데이터베이스 전문가들은 지난 수년간 GUI 기반의 도구를 사용해 왔습니다. 이러한 도구는 기능이 다양하고, 스크립트 개체 정의를 마우스 오른쪽 버튼으로 클릭하여 볼 […]

AWS Data Migration Service(DMS)를 활용하여 Amazon Aurora PostgreSQL 블루/그린 배포 환경 생성하기

데이터베이스 운영 안정성 및 다운타임은 애플리케이션을 운영하는 관점에서 매우 중요합니다. 데이터베이스 운영 시 발생하는 파라미터 변경 또는 데이터베이스 버전 업그레이드하는 경우 필연적으로 다운타임이 발생하며 이에 소요되는 시간도 예측하기 어렵습니다. 데이터베이스가 단일 소스의 원천으로 구성되어 있는 아키텍쳐에서 데이터베이스의 운영 관리 측면에서 발생하는 이런 다운타임은 최종 사용자가 사용하는 애플리케이션의 가용성에 크게 영향을 미칩니다. 이런 상황에서 블루/그린 환경 […]